Its not about being hard, is about money…most guys looking for 200hp NA are on a budget, usually can’t afford to swap or go turbo or are lacking the skills to do so…you will need an advanced ems like sds or aem, so thats 1000-2000 right there…its not just I/H/E like most only dream it was…pistions, rods too if you wanna rev the KA, valvetrain, cams, p&p, lightweight pully’s/flywheel/driveshaft, etc…posibly ITB’s and a coil on plug ignition…basicaly its going to cost the same as a 400+hp turbo setup on a KA with only minimal difference in reliability…more power to ya if ya do, but for your average joe its not worth it…be fun for auto x though!

Coil on plug ignition??? Most people get rid of that due to the fact the coil packs get heat soaked and crap out and are not stong enough. If you want to upgrade you get LS1 Coils…Which have spark plug wires.
i think you’d be better off looking on the SE-R forums about the SQR23DE setup. it takes an NA QR and uses SR crank and custom pistons and rods. the result is something phenomenal. the guy who engineered it is looking for 250-270whp NA! the turbo version already made 393 HP.
before you go off and think that’s FWD, there are RWD QR’s in trucks, and there’s probably a bellhousing adaptor that’ll work with the KA transmission.
